    Simple Ingredients

    The ingredients are simple and few. Only 4 ingredients to make these little cuties!

    • Chocolate chips
    • Unrefined coconut oil
    • Full fat coconut milk
    • Chopped walnuts
    Mini Chocolate Walnut Freezer Fudge Bites

    Freezer Fudge in Silicon Molds

    Like I said, I used the very small silicon muffin molds to make mine. I’m sure you could make them bigger or you could also spread them out in a pan and cut into squares after they’re firmed up.

    No matter which way you make them, make sure to have a napkin handy because they can be very messy! Finger licking is acceptable also!

    Chocolate Walnut Freezer Fudge Bites

    These freezer fudge bites are very easy & quick to make and have only 4 ingredients!
    Prep Time5 minutes mins
    Cook Time10 minutes mins
    Total Time15 minutes mins
    Course: Healthy snack or treat
    Cuisine: Vegan/Vegetarian
    Keyword: Chocolate Walnut Freezer Fudge
    Servings: 10 -12 mini
    Author: Deb Delozier | Vegelicious Kitchen

    Ingredients

    • 1 1/4 cups dark chocolate chips melted
    • 1 Tablespoons unrefined coconut oil melted
    • 1/2 cup full fat coconut milk
    • Chopped walnuts for the top

    Instructions

    • Place a metal bowl over a pot of hot, almost boiling water - DO NOT LET THE WATER TOUCH THE BOTTOM OF THE BOWL
    • Put your chocolate chips and your coconut oil to melt together in the bowl, stirring until melted
    • Stir in the 1/2 cup full fat coconut milk
    • Pour the mixture into tiny silicon muffin forms and top with chopped walnuts
    • Place in the refrigerator or freezer for at least an hour to firm up
    • Store in the refrigerator or freezer
    • *NOTE - These need to be eaten right away from the fridge or freezer - they can't sit out or they'll become too soft. Also - Keep a napkin handy because they're messy but worth it!
